Que saben de los paises pobres y ricos? Es urgente xd

Biology
1 answer:
aev [14]3 years ago
7 0

Answer: La diferencia entre países pobres y ricos, tampoco está en sus recursos naturales, pues Japón tiene un territorio muy pequeño y su 80 % es montañoso, malo para la agricultura y ganado. Sin embargo es una de las primeras potencias económicas del mundo. Su territorio es como una gran fábrica flotante que recibe materia prima de todo el mundo y los exporta transformados, acumulando su riqueza.

Histones are 8 subunit proteins that cells use to pack DNA into the manageable condensed chromosomes you are used to seeing duri
Shtirlitz [24]

Answer: Arginine and Lysine

Explanation:

Histones are protein that packs DNA into nucleosomes. It compose of Arginine and Lysine amino acids.

Lysine and Arginine are basic amino acids that aids the solubility of Histone in water and also aids the interaction of DNA and Histones.

Where are chromosomes located during metaphase?
77julia77 [94]

Answer:

C

Explanation:

In metaphase, the chromosomes are lined up along the center, or equatorial plate, of the cell and each sister chromatid  faces opposite poles.
